Nwaozuzu is an Igbo name from Nigeria meaning 'child of the divine oracle' or 'child of prophecy.' 'Nwa' means child, while 'ozuzu' refers to an oracle or divine message. Traditionally, it symbolizes a child believed to carry spiritual insight or destiny, often given in families valuing ancestral wisdom and divine guidance.

Cultural Significance of Nwaozuzu

In Igbo culture, names like Nwaozuzu carry deep spiritual and ancestral weight. They often reflect a family's hope that the child will embody divine wisdom or be guided by spiritual prophecy. Such names are traditionally given during naming ceremonies and are believed to influence the child's path and character. The name connects the child to the community's mystical heritage and serves as a constant reminder of their cultural roots.
